Medroxyprogesterone acetate
Medroxyprogesterone acetate (also known as Medroxyprogesterone 17-acetate, Provera, Depo-Provera, Metigestrona, Gestapuran, Perlutex, Veramix, Methylacetoxyprogesterone, Medroxyacetate progesterone or Depcorlutin) is a substance of the steroid class.
